A high-efficiency HVAC system operates with minimal energy waste while maintaining optimal indoor climate control. Various factors contribute to a system’s efficiency, such as its Seasonal Energy Efficiency Ratio (SEER) rating for cooling systems and the Annual Fuel Utilization Efficiency (AFUE) rating for heating systems. 

The higher the rating, the more energy-efficient the system is. By upgrading to a system with higher efficiency ratings, you’re not only reducing your energy consumption but also lowering your greenhouse gas emissions, which play a significant role in climate change.

Practical Tips for Maximizing Your HVAC System’s Efficiency

While upgrading to a high-efficiency HVAC system is an effective way to reduce your carbon footprint, there are additional steps you can take to improve your existing system’s efficiency and further decrease energy consumption:

1. Regular Maintenance: Schedule regular maintenance with a professional HVAC service provider like Climate Experts to ensure that your system is running optimally, free of dust or debris that could hamper efficiency.

2. Air Filter Replacement: Replace or clean your air filters regularly to maintain proper airflow and prevent your system from working harder than necessary, which could lead to increased energy consumption.

3. Programmable Thermostat: Install a programmable thermostat to manage the temperature of your home or business effectively and avoid energy waste by heating or cooling spaces only when necessary.

4. Insulation and Sealing: Make sure your building is properly insulated and sealed to reduce the loss of conditioned air through cracks, gaps, or poorly sealed windows and doors.

5. Proper System Sizing: Ensure that your HVAC system is appropriately sized for your home or business, as an oversized or undersized system can result in energy inefficiency and compromised indoor comfort.

High-Efficiency System Options

There are several types of high-efficiency HVAC system options available to cater to varying needs and preferences. Here are some popular choices:

1. Energy-Efficient Furnaces: High-efficiency gas furnaces have an AFUE rating of 90% or higher, meaning that they effectively convert 90% or more of the fuel they consume into heat. This efficiency can lead to substantial energy savings and reduce greenhouse gas emissions.

2. Heat Pumps: Heat pumps are an energy-efficient alternative to traditional furnaces and air conditioning systems. By transferring heat from one location to another instead of generating it, heat pumps can provide both heating and cooling with lower energy consumption.

3. Ductless Mini-Split Systems: As discussed in a previous blog post, ductless mini-split systems are an efficient, versatile solution for homes and businesses without existing ductwork infrastructure. Their zoning capabilities allow for precise temperature control and minimised energy waste.

4. Geothermal Systems: Although upfront costs are typically higher, geothermal systems offer exceptional energy efficiency by harnessing stable temperatures from the earth to provide heating and cooling. These systems can lead to significant long-term energy savings and have a lower environmental impact.

Choosing the Right System for Your Needs

Given the variety of high-efficiency HVAC systems available, it’s essential to assess your specific needs to determine the best fit for your home or business. Factors to consider when selecting a system include:

1. Climate: The local climate or temperature variations will play a critical role in determining which system is best suited to your needs. For instance, heat pumps are generally more effective in climates with moderate heating and cooling requirements.

2. Existing Infrastructure: Consider the current infrastructure of your home or business, such as the presence of ductwork or the feasibility of installing certain systems, like a geothermal system, which requires sufficient outdoor space.

3. Budget: While investing in a high-efficiency HVAC system can yield long-term savings, consider your upfront budget when selecting a system. Ensure that the investment aligns with your financial goals, and take advantage of government incentives or rebates when available.

4. Comfort and Noise Levels: Consider the comfort and noise levels provided by various systems, especially if you’re installing one in a residential setting where quiet operation is essential.
